India thrash Ireland in third Test

August 04, 2004 14:31 IST
Source:PTI

The Indian hockey team bounced back from their shock defeat to thrash Ireland 6-2 to win the third and last Test in Cologne, Germany.

Star striker Gagan Ajit Singh and Sandeep Singh led the Athens bound team's charge with a brace each. Veteran forward Dhanraj Pillay and skipper Dilip Tirkey scored the other two goals in last night's win.

The Indians had suffered a jolt in the second Test when they went down 2-3 to Ireland after winning the first Test 2-0 on Sunday.
